Instructional Designer
Russell Tobin is focused on enhancing customer experience through effective learning solutions. The Instructional Designer / Learning & Development Strategist is responsible for designing, developing, and delivering impactful learning programs that align with organizational goals and foster continuous improvement.
Responsibilities
Conduct job-task analyses and needs assessments to define learning objectives and identify appropriate training solutions
Partner with managers and team members to establish training goals and develop focused curricula that enhance employee capability
Apply instructional design principles and adult learning theories to develop content in collaboration with subject matter experts
Design and implement blended learning solutions using methods such as instructor-led training, simulations, role-plays, and e-learning
Update and refine existing training materials and design evaluation methods to assess learning effectiveness and drive continuous improvement
Collaborate with business leaders to identify strategic training goals and required competencies
Review and optimize existing curricula to improve instructional effectiveness
Promote innovative learning solutions by staying current with emerging learning technologies and methodologies
Define SMART objectives and success metrics for all training programs and evaluate impact using qualitative and quantitative data
Build strong relationships across organizational levels to align learning initiatives and secure stakeholder buy-in
Partner with business units to develop learning strategies and implementation roadmaps
Coordinate with content, design, and development teams to ensure timely, cost-effective, and high-quality delivery
Champion user-centered design and effective storytelling to influence decision-making and engagement
Independently manage learning projects, including planning, risk management, and execution
Facilitate and deliver training sessions as needed
Support additional initiatives and responsibilities aligned with organizational goals in a dynamic environment
